Blowing in the wind

Blowing in the wind

I know why the cage bird sings.

It sings because it's the closest thing to flight;

To feel the breeze between your brittle, beaten wings,

The bounding wind blowing, billowing around your body,

through your bones,

Like the sighs at the end of the song,

My mother used to sing when I was just small.

Still I'm small.

"I'm not very big yet God" she would say.

Dismay.

A rainy day.

Singing in a cage,

Because we can't go outside in the rain and fly,

We have to build up our strength inside.

To weather the harsh, raging storms laying ahead in the sky.
